Vacation Rentals

Luxury Townhome P2 - On the Point
Adirondacks (Adirondack Mountains) > Inlet
Townhouse, Bedroom(s): 3, Sleeps: 8
Townhome P2 is part of the newly constructed, luxury homes on the point called The Manor House.
$550 - $630 /Night